Exchange
Companies
Rankings
More
Toggle theme
Sign In
People
Tod Francis
TF
Tod Francis
Companies
1
Current Roles
1
Past Roles
0
Investor Roles
0
Current Positions
Canva
Board Member
Co-Founder & Managing Director
Multimedia and Design Software
Contact
••••••@••••••
Unlock Contact Info